Bitcoin Exchange Coinbase Makes Major Updates to the Coinbase 50 Index! Which Altcoins Have Been Added? Here Are the Details

Coinbase has announced an update regarding its fourth-quarter index rebalancing process.

The exchange announced significant changes to the Coinbase 50 Index (COIN50), which tracks the 50 largest crypto assets in the market and is designed for institutional investors. Six new crypto assets have been added to the index, while six tokens with declining performance and market weight have been removed.

The statement announced that the new assets included in the COIN50 index are Hedera (HBAR), Mantle (MANTLE), VeChain (VET), Flare (FLR), Sei (SEI), and Immutable (IMX). Coinbase stated that the recent growth in trading volume, network activity, and market capitalization of these six assets was a determining factor in their inclusion in the index.

The inclusion of projects such as IMX, which has increased institutional investor interest, and Sei, which stands out in Tier-1 ecosystems, in the index is considered an important step in reflecting the changing dynamics of the market.

Additionally, six tokens, SKL, AKT, LPT, SNX, HNT, and CVX, were removed from the index. Coinbase Institutional stated that the market weight of these projects within the COIN50 criteria had decreased, weakening their representation in the index. It emphasized that this regular rebalancing process is critical for the index to accurately and up-to-dately reflect the overall market structure.

These changes made by Coinbase will not only be effective in the portfolio structuring of institutional investors but also provide important clues about the direction of liquidity flows in the crypto market.
